What are Cookies?

Cookies are small text files containing a string of characters that are placed on your device when you visit a website. They allow the website to recognize your browser and remember certain information about your visit. Cookies can be “persistent” or “session” cookies. Persistent cookies remain on your device for a set period or until you delete them, while session cookies are deleted when you close your browser.

  • Performance/Analytical Cookies: These cookies allow us to count visits and traffic sources to measure and improve the performance of our site. They help us know which pages are the most and least popular and see how visitors move around the site. All information these cookies collect is aggregated and therefore anonymous. If you do not allow these cookies, we will not know when you have visited our site.
  • Targeting/Advertising Cookies: These cookies may be set through our site by our advertising partners. They may be used by those companies to build a profile of your interests and show you relevant adverts on other sites. They do not store personal information directly, but are based on uniquely identifying your browser and internet device. If you do not allow these cookies, you will experience less targeted advertising.
